'''Seoul Subway Line 3''' (dubbed ''The Orange Line'') of the [[Seoul Metropolitan Subway]] is a [[rapid transit]] service that connects [[Eunpyeong District]] to Gangnam and southeastern Seoul. Most trains head further northwest to serve [[Goyang]] via the [[Ilsan Line]].<ref>{{Cite web|title=서울교통공사 블로그 : 네이버 블로그|url=https://blog.naver.com/seoulmetro01/120166938133|access-date=2021-05-31|website=blog.naver.com}}</ref> In 2021, the Seoul Metro operated section had an annual ridership of 295,930,000 or 810,767 passengers per day.<ref>{{Cite web|title=서울시 지하철수송 통계|url=http://data.seoul.go.kr/dataList/273/S/2/datasetView.do#none|access-date=2022-07-19|website=data.seoul.go.kr|language=ko}}</ref>

In December 2010 the line is recorded as having the second highest WiFi data consumption in the Seoul Metropolitan area. It averaged 1.8 times more than the other 14 subway lines fitted with WiFi service zones.<ref>{{cite news|title=Seoul Subway Line No. 2 Becomes Major WiFi Hotspot|url=http://english.chosun.com/site/data/html_dir/2010/12/24/2010122401037.html|access-date=April 25, 2012|newspaper=Chosun Ilbo|date=24 December 2010}}</ref>

== History ==
Construction began in 1980, and the first section of Line 3 opened (Gupabal–Yangjae; Jichuk opened in 1990) after the completion of work in two stages during 1985, along with subway [[Seoul Subway Line 4|Line 4]]. In October 1993, a second extension to the south was opened (Yangjae–Suseo).

In March 1996, the [[Korail]] [[Ilsan Line]] opened and allowed Line 3 trains to [[Through train|through operate]] all the way to the city of [[Goyang]]. There are 2 depots near [[Jichuk station]] and [[Suseo station]], which are for both Korail and Seoul Metro.

A 3&nbsp;km extension opened on February 18, 2010, stretching from Suseo to Garak Market ([[Seoul Subway Line 8|Line 8]]) and Ogeum ([[Seoul Subway Line 5|Line 5]]).

On December 27, 2014, [[Wonheung station]] opened between [[Wondang station|Wondang]] and [[Samsong station|Samsong]] stations.

== Tourism ==
In January 2013, the [[Seoul Metropolitan Rapid Transit Corporation]], published free guidebooks in three languages: English, Japanese and Chinese (simplified and traditional), which features eight tours as well as recommendations for accommodations, restaurants and shopping centers. The tours are designed with different themes for travel along the subway lines, e.g. Korean traditional culture. Which goes from [[Jongno 3-ga station]] to [[Anguk station]] and [[Gyeongbokgung station]] on this line that showcases antique shops and art galleries of [[Insa-dong]].<ref>{{cite news|last=Kwon|first=Sang-soo|title=Free guide for Seoul's subway riders|url=http://koreajoongangdaily.joinsmsn.com/news/article/Article.aspx?aid=2966140|access-date=January 27, 2013|newspaper=Joongang Daily|date=January 26, 2013|url-status=usurped|arch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20130412000655/http://koreajoongangdaily.joinsmsn.com/news/article/Article.aspx?aid=2966140|archive-date=April 12, 2013|df=mdy-all}}</ref>
